A recently built luxury detached house in an enviable setting in the village of Blean, to the north side of Canterbury. The property was individually designed for the location by quality architects CDP Architects and was constructed by Tim Day Construction Ltd. The house enjoys an NHBC Buildmark warranty with impressive specifications and meticulous detail. Extending to approx. 377 sq. meters the property offers extensive and versatile accommodation of elegant proportions. On the ground floor is an impressive reception hall with a staircase rising to the partially galleried first floor landing. The kitchen is comprehensively fitted with a range of Integra Soho units complemented by stunning Nero Cosmos granite worksurfaces and a central island. There are a comprehensive range of AEG appliances including ovens, fridge, freezer, hob, wine cooler, and dishwasher. The utility room houses a convenient large capacity washing machine and Hotpoint heat pump tumble dryer. There are three reception rooms, to the rear is a large sitting room with a part-vaulted ceiling and two sets of French doors overlooking and opening onto the gardens. There is a substantial dining room to the side and a separate family room/study to the front. On the first floor is an impressive large central landing and there are five bedrooms, all with ensuite bath or shower rooms with automatic lighting and high-quality fittings, sanitary ware, and tiling. The property benefits from contemporary high spec systems including a 16kw Samsung EHS Monobloc heat pump providing hot water and serving the underfloor central heating system, there are low energy LED lighting with dimmers in the main accommodation, and the sitting room features a Farringdon Catalyst Eco Wood-burning stove.

The property is approached by a permeable brick-paved driveway through solid timber remote control security gates with video intercom onto the main drive which reaches the front of the property with ample parking and access to the large double garage. The garage has an insulated sectional door with a remote control.

To the front the gardens comprise lawn with borders and a lit path gives access to a pedestrian gate onto Moat Lane subsequently leading to Rough Common Road. The lawns extend to the side and rear of the house and at the rear is a large brick-paved seating area ideal for eating out and entertaining. Around the exterior is automatic lighting and security cameras. The main plot (including the house) measures approx. 140ft (42.64m) deep x 104ft (31.68m) wide.

The property is located in an enviable setting in the village of Blean. The house is ideally situated for the Independent Schools of St. Edmund's and Kent College whilst Canterbury City centre and Canterbury West Station are easily accessible. It is a short walk to the highly regarded Blean Primary School. Nearby Rough Common provides a local general store incorporating Post Office. Blean Woods offers extensive walking and the Crab and Winkle Way is a delightful walk or cycle ride through to Whitstable. Easy access can be gained on to the A2, linking with the M2 and M20 motorways.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ed: obtained from Ofcom on January 7, 2022

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ength: obtained from Ofcom on January 7, 2022

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
